The company has reportedly undertaken a significant revision of its 2026 revenue forecast, reducing it by a full third. This notable adjustment stems from an acknowledged over-reliance on cutting-edge frontier models supplied by external providers, which were integral to driving the AI functionalities across its platform.
Providing clarity in an update to shareholders, CEO Melanie Perkins, as cited by Startup Daily, explained the underlying challenges. She stated: “Several of our first-party models were not yet ready for release, and our pricing, consumption model and usage controls had not caught up with the outsized demand we were seeing.”
